Welcome to the Crashline team at Mottlebird. Our pipeline ingests crash reports from the Pinefall mobile app, deduplicates stack traces, and writes symbolicated results to the triage store. New hires should run the ingest worker locally before touching production. To point your worker at the staging triage database, use the following connection string.

replica DSN, kajep-yahag: mssql://praok_svc:iF@db-8d68.plorvaio.local:5432/eliion

Break-glass access for Moontide, the tide-table widget maintained by the Shorelark team, is reserved for outages where the prediction cache cannot rebuild itself. Invoking break-glass bypasses normal review, so log the incident number first. The emergency console will prompt for the standing recovery passphrase, which is kept current on the line below.

unlock words, tagaf-yageg: holwyn-ulaael

- [ ] **Step 7: Breaker override escrow.** After sealing the signing keys for the Tallgrove upstream API circuit breaker, confirm the support team can force the breaker open during a full outage. The override bundle lives in the sealed escrow drawer and is useless without its unlock phrase. Two ceremony witnesses must initial this step before proceeding. The escrow bundle is decrypted with the recovery passphrase that follows.

vault phrase of kahip-kahop = holath-quenmir